How to Hire Remote Developers from India: A Step-by-Step Process (2026 Guide)
With a vast pool of skilled professionals and growing AI-enabled hiring platforms, finding and managing top tech talent is easier than ever. Here’s a detailed, step-by-step process you can follow:

Step 1: Write a Clear, SEO-Optimized Job Description
Start with clarity. A well-written job description helps your listing appear in both Google search results and AI-driven hiring platforms.
Include the following details:
-
Required tech stack: Mention specific frameworks or languages (e.g., React, Node.js, Python).
-
Project duration: Short-term contract, 6-month project, or full-time engagement.
-
Time zone overlap: Define your preferred working hours or flexibility.
-
Tools & workflow: Specify collaboration tools like Slack, Jira, or GitHub.
Step 2: Shortlist and Evaluate Developers Efficiently
Once applications start coming in, focus on identifying the right talent by combining technical evaluation with soft skill assessment. Evaluate developers based on:
- Coding skills: Conduct technical tests using tools like HackerRank, Codility, or TestGorilla.
- Problem-solving ability: Include real-world coding challenges related to your actual project.
- Soft skills: Assess communication, time management, and ownership, all critical for remote collaboration.

Step 3: Conduct Smart and Structured Interviews
To save time and improve accuracy, adopt a two-tier interview process:
- Technical Evaluation: Conduct live coding sessions, debugging tests, or system design discussions. Involve senior engineers or use AI tools like InterviewGPT or HireVue AI to analyze responses for accuracy and efficiency.
- Cultural & Communication Fit: Evaluate if the candidate aligns with your team’s communication style, project workflow, and company values. Look for candidates who proactively share updates, respect deadlines, and show initiative.
Step 4: Onboard Developers with a Structured Plan
Once you’ve selected your remote developer, focus on seamless onboarding; it’s key to productivity and retention. Provide:
-
Access to key resources: Documentation, credentials, repositories, and communication channels (Slack, Trello, or Notion).
-
Clear expectations: Define KPIs, deliverables, and sprint objectives.
-
Regular syncs: Schedule weekly or biweekly meetings to align goals and progress.
Leverage tools like Notion AI, Linear AI, or ClickUp AI to automate task tracking, goal setting, and feedback loops.
A smooth onboarding process ensures faster integration, reduced downtime, and better collaboration, helping your remote team perform like an in-house one.
Top Technology Stacks Remote Developers Use in 2026
Here are the most in-demand tech stacks powering global development teams:
| Stack | Description |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| MERN Stack (MongoDB, Express.js, React.js, Node.js) | Full-stack JS framework for scalable web apps | SaaS, dashboards, marketplaces |
| MEVN Stack (MongoDB, Express.js, Vue.js, Node.js) | Lightweight and reactive web framework | Real-time and interactive apps |
| Serverless (AWS Lambda, Azure Functions) | Backend-less development for scalability | Microservices, APIs |
| AI + Python (LangChain, FastAPI, PyTorch) | AI-powered automation and web app integration | Intelligent apps and chatbots |
| Flutter + Firebase | Cross-platform mobile development | iOS + Android app development |
